Description
Summary:
"16 years-old Dario got away from home, running from his familiar hell. Luismi, his unconditional friend, Caralimpia, a poor looser in a winners suit and Antonia, an old lady that collects abandoned furniture in her three weeler will become his new family. Three generations meet in city thats too big to be alone. Its summertime."--IMDb.com, viewed May 12, 2016.
